What causes yellow spots in advanced cataracts?
Yellow spots in advanced cataracts result from protein accumulation and oxidative changes in the lens over time. These brown or yellow discolorations indicate the cataract has progressed and may affect your vision quality.
Can advanced cataracts with yellow spots be treated?
Yes, cataract surgery is the primary treatment for advanced cataracts. During surgery, the clouded lens is removed and replaced with an artificial lens implant to restore clear vision.
Should I see a doctor about yellow spots and cataracts?
Yes, schedule an eye exam promptly. A comprehensive evaluation by an ophthalmologist will determine the cataract severity and whether surgery is recommended to prevent further vision loss.
